[PATCH v5 2/7] x86/sev: Create snp_prepare()

From: Tycho Andersen

Date: Thu Mar 26 2026 - 12:19:32 EST


From: "Tycho Andersen (AMD)" <tycho@xxxxxxxxxx>

In preparation for delayed SNP initialization, create a function
snp_prepare() that does the necessary architecture setup.
Export this function for the ccp module to allow it to do the setup as
necessary.

Introduce a cpu_read_lock/unlock() wrapper around the MFDM and SNP enable.
While CPU hotplug is not supported, this makes sure that the bit setting
happens on the same set of CPUs in both cases. This improvement was
suggested by Sashiko:
https://sashiko.dev/#/patchset/20260324161301.1353976-1-tycho%40kernel.org

Also move {mfd,snp}_enable out of the __init section, since these will be
called later.
